Die Beiden aus Verona

Alternative title
Those Two from Verona
Synopsis
Gert Hofmann’s radio drama re-visits the story of Shakespeare’s Romeo and Juliet, examining the myth of everlasting love. Through divine intervention by Jupiter, the lovers in Hofmann’s version do not die, instead they are given the chance to grow old together. The plot begins with the old couple appearing in front of the celestial court because they managed to kill each other after 50 years of married life. Flashbacks to how it all started suggest that the quality of their love might be everlasting but not in everyday life. The couple gets a second chance to decide when they are transported back to the moment of their initial ‘Liebestod’ ... Produced by Hans-Dieter Schwarze with music by Friedrich Zehm.
